About UWP Consulting
Founded in 1972, UWP Consulting (Pty) Ltd is a multidisciplinary consulting engineering company from South Africa, which is largely excluded. UWP is headquartered in Johannesburg and has approximately 250 employees in 4 offices in South Africa and 10 offices in South Africa.
The company provides a variety of services in various fields, including integrated transportation services; water conservancy engineering services; planning and project management services; infrastructure planning services; industrial, commercial, civil, residential, sanitation and institutional structure services, and niche and Specific department services.
UWP goal is to become one of the recognized leading suppliers of value-added engineering solutions and improve the quality of life of people in sub-Saharan Africa.
UWP Consulting aims to help educate and train young students in the engineering field to meet the capabilities required by the company.
The scholarship program is awarded to undergraduate (BSc (Eng) / BEng / BTech) and postgraduate civil engineering students.
ELIGIBILITY REQUIREMENTS
Applicants must satisfy the following minimum entry criteria before applying (please note that failure to satisfy all the requirements will lead to your application not being considered):
- South African citizen
- Completed Matric
- Studying towards a Civil Engineering qualification (BSc Eng/ BTech/ BEng/ Postgraduate)
- Undergraduate students: completed all first year subjects
- Postgraduate students: studying towards a Civil Engineering BTech, BEng or BSc (Eng) qualification
- Studying at an accredited tertiary institution in South Africa (Technikon or University)
- *Preference will be given to those from a previously disadvantaged community
HOW TO APPLY FOR THE BURSARY
The application must be made online: http://www.uwp.co.za/bursaryapplications/
Please submit a clear copy of the following supporting documents along with your online application (these documents are required; if any items are missing, your application will not Will be considered):
- Identification documents (certified copy)
- Enrollment and transcripts (certified copy)
- Complete transcripts to date (on higher education letterhead)
- Last higher education expense report (including all Breakdown of study expenses)
- References that can be contacted
- UWP Grant Attachment 1 (pdf): References completed by your university or technical staff
